apr
系统.对象
└apr.时间
本类提供了操作时间的方法。
方法摘要 | |
---|---|
公开 静态 文本 | 取当前时间() 本方法返回自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。 |
公开 静态 文本 | 转为机器时间(文本 时间) 本方法将ANSI时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回微秒数,失败返回空文本。 |
公开 静态 apr.时间表达式 | 转为可读时间(文本 时间, 整数 偏移秒数) 本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。 |
公开 静态 apr.时间表达式 | 转为GMT可读时间(文本 时间) 本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为GMT(格林尼治)可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。 |
公开 静态 apr.时间表达式 | 转为本地时区可读时间(文本 时间) 本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为本地时区可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。 |
公开 静态 文本 | 可读时间转为机器时间(apr.时间表达式 时间表达式对象) 本方法将可读时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。 |
公开 静态 文本 | GMT可读时间转为机器时间(apr.时间表达式 时间表达式对象) 本方法将格林尼治可读时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回微秒数,失败返回空文本。 |
公开 静态 | 休眠(文本 微秒数) 将进程挂起休眠,在指定的微秒数到达后进程被唤醒,或者在调用进程捕捉到一个信号并从信号处理程序返回时唤醒。 |
公开 静态 文本 | 格式化(文本 格式, apr.时间表达式 时间表达式对象, 整数 长度 = 50) 本方法设置返回码,成功返回时间,失败返回空文本。 |
公开 静态 文本 | 计算毫秒数(文本 微秒数) 成功返回毫秒数,失败返回空文本。 |
公开 静态 文本 | 计算微秒数(文本 秒数) 成功返回微秒数,失败返回空文本。 |
公开 静态 文本 | 计算微秒数(文本 秒数, 文本 微秒数) 成功返回微秒数,失败返回空文本。 |
公开 静态 文本 | 计算毫秒数余数(文本 微秒数) 微秒数除以1000再除以1000取余,即不足秒的毫秒数。成功返回毫秒数余数,失败返回空文本。 |
公开 静态 文本 | 计算秒数(文本 微秒数) 成功返回秒数,失败返回空文本。 |
公开 静态 文本 | 计算微秒数余数(文本 微秒数) 微秒数除以1000000取余,即不足秒的微秒数。成功返回微秒数余数,失败返回空文本。 |
从 系统.对象 继承的方法 |
比较类型, 是否实现, 取类名, 发送事件, 等于, 比较, 到文本, 比较引用 |
本方法返回自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。
本方法将ANSI时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回微秒数,失败返回空文本。
参数:
时间 - 单位为秒数。
本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。
参数:
时间 - 单位为微秒数。
偏移秒数
本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为GMT(格林尼治)可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。
参数:
时间 - 单位为微秒数。
本方法将自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数转换为本地时区可读时间。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。
参数:
时间 - 单位为微秒数。
本方法将可读时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回时间表达式对象,失败返回空对象。
参数:
时间表达式对象
本方法将格林尼治可读时间转换为自1970年、UTC(协调世界时 Universal Time Coordinated)、1月1日、00:00:00起计时的微秒数。本方法设置返回码,成功返回微秒数,失败返回空文本。
参数:
时间表达式对象
将进程挂起休眠,在指定的微秒数到达后进程被唤醒,或者在调用进程捕捉到一个信号并从信号处理程序返回时唤醒。
参数:
微秒数 - 要休眠的微秒数。
本方法设置返回码,成功返回时间,失败返回空文本。
参数:
格式 - 常用的格式有(不保证在所有平台都有如下实现): %a(星期几的缩写)、 %A(星期几的全名)、 %b(月份名称的缩写)、 %B(月份名称的全名)、 %c(标准的日期的时间串)、 %C(年份的后两位数字)、 %d(用数字表示本月的第几天 (范围为 00 至 31))、 %D(月/天/年)、 %e(在两字符域中,十进制表示的每月的第几天)、 %F(年-月-日)、 %g(年份的后两位数字,使用基于周的年)、 %G(年分,使用基于周的年)、 %h(简写的月份名)、 %H(用24 小时制数字表示小时数 (范围为 00 至 23))、 %I(用 12 小时制数字表示小时数 (范围为 01 至 12))、 %j(以数字表示当年的第几天 (范围为 001 至 366))、 %m(十进制表示的月份 (范围由 1 至 12)、 %M(分钟数。 %p 以 'AM' 或 'PM' 表示本地端时间)、 %n(新行符)、 %p(本地的AM或PM的等价显示)、 %r(12小时的时间)、 %R(显示小时和分钟:hh:mm)、 %S(秒数)、 %t(水平制表符)、 %T(显示时分秒:hh:mm:ss)、 %u(每周的第几天,星期一为第一天 (值从0到6,星期一为0))、 %U(数字表示为本年度的第几周,第一个星期由第一个周日开始)、 %V(每年的第几周,使用基于周的年)、 %w(十进制表示的星期几(值从0到6,星期天为0))、 %W(数字表示为本年度的第几周(值从0到53))、 %x(不含时间的日期表示法)、 %X(不含日期的时间表示法)、 %y(不带世纪的十进制年份(范围由 00 至 99))、 %Y(带世纪部分的十进制年份,完整的年份数字表示,即四位数)、 %z %Z(时区或名称缩写)。
时间表达式对象
长度 - 转换后文本的长度,单位为字节。
成功返回毫秒数,失败返回空文本。
参数:
微秒数 - 该参数以微秒为单位。
成功返回微秒数,失败返回空文本。
参数:
秒数 - 该参数以秒为单位。
成功返回微秒数,失败返回空文本。
参数:
秒数 - 该参数以秒为单位。
微秒数 - 该参数以微秒为单位。
微秒数除以1000再除以1000取余,即不足秒的毫秒数。成功返回毫秒数余数,失败返回空文本。
参数:
微秒数 - 该参数以微秒为单位。
成功返回秒数,失败返回空文本。
参数:
微秒数 - 该参数以微秒为单位。
微秒数除以1000000取余,即不足秒的微秒数。成功返回微秒数余数,失败返回空文本。
参数:
微秒数 - 该参数以微秒为单位。